Georgia - Export of High Tenacity Nylon Yarn
Since 2014, Georgia Export of High Tenacity Nylon Yarn rose 15.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 86 comparing other countries in Export of High Tenacity Nylon Yarn at $1,799.03. Georgia is overtaken by Paraguay, which was ranked number 85 at $2,348 and is followed by Kenya at $1,609.89. China lead the ranking with $416,112,560.33 in 2019, that is +2% compared to 2018. United States, Belgium and South Korea resp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Madagascar witnessed the best average annual growth at +248.5% per year, while Namibia was the worst growing country at -76% per year.
